Stores

Stores


boutique: a small specialty store that sells goods carefully chosen for a particular type of customer and usually offers unique items that are not available at chain stores

  • Her sister has individual style and shops only at boutiques.


box store: a large chain store that has a similar structure and layout in each location

  • If you need hardware for a project, you can go to a local hardware store or to a big box store.


chain store: one of many stores owned and operated by the same company

  • With so many chain stores, our cities are becoming more alike.


department store: a large store that usually has several floors, elevators and escalators, and separate departments for each type of purchase—for example, women's clothing, men's clothing, children's clothing, shoes, linens, kitchen equipment, etc.

  • It is very convenient to shop at a department store where you can find things for the whole family as well as household goods.


discount store: a store that sells goods at a lower price than the one suggested by the manufacturer

  • You can save a lot of money by buying at a discount store, but you don't get any help in selecting your purchases.


mall store: a chain store often located with other chain stores in a shopping mall

  • My friend loves to shop at her favorite mall stores.


outlet: a store that sells goods from a particular manufacturer, at a lower price

  • Outlets are often grouped together in malls on the outskirts of cities.
